Output 1f239972ebfbb5a399a697c2d1593d14a9eb34be33d7a21ad8a51bcc31f1707e:11

value
52684900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e652a7891a8c775ebf1bdaee93fe1f26b8a2c964 OP_EQUAL
address
3NgrMbVx3bBfew6jN5jDoTwfcFGsnDY2Sa
transaction
1f239972ebfbb5a399a697c2d1593d14a9eb34be33d7a21ad8a51bcc31f1707e
confirmations
326582
spent
true